Autor Beitrag
Daiserja
Hält's aus hier
Beiträge: 8



BeitragVerfasst: Di 02.03.10 10:24 
Hallo Zusammen,

bei der Erstellung eines Crystal Reports bekomme ich den Fehler: "Der Bericht enthält keine Tabellen".

Ich verwende Visual Studio 2008 (c#).

Ich habe einen Report erstellt, der auch im Feld-Explorer unter Datenbankfelder die Tabelle "tStruktur" mit den Feldern "TabName" und "Feldname" enthält.

Wenn ich nun folgendes versuche, bekomme ich den oben genannten Fehler.

ausblenden C#-Quelltext
1:
2:
3:
4:
5:
6:
7:
8:
9:
10:
11:
12:
13:
14:
15:
16:
17:
18:
19:
20:
21:
22:
23:
           DataSet myData = new DataSet();

            OleDbCommand cmd = new OleDbCommand();
            OleDbDataAdapter myAdapter = new OleDbDataAdapter();
            
            connLOC.Open();

            cmd.CommandText = "SELECT TabName, Feldname FROM tStruktur ";
            cmd.Connection = connLOC;

            myAdapter.SelectCommand = cmd;
            myAdapter.Fill(myData, "tStruktur");
           
            CrystalReport1 objRpt = new CrystalReport1();
            objRpt.Load(@"D:\CrystalReport5.rpt");


            objRpt.SetDataSource(myData.Tables["tStruktur"]);

            crystalReportViewer1.ReportSource = objRpt;
            crystalReportViewer1.Refresh();
            
            connLOC.Close();


Kann mir jemand sagen, wo der Fehler liegt? Bin für alle Tips dankbar!

Danke und Grüße
Andreas

Moderiert von user profile iconChristian S.: Quote- durch C#-Tags ersetzt
Daiserja Threadstarter
Hält's aus hier
Beiträge: 8



BeitragVerfasst: Do 04.03.10 12:28 
Ok, habe das Problem gelöst.